What is SAM.gov?

SAM.gov is the official U.S. government system for federal procurement. It lists all contract opportunities that federal agencies are required to post publicly. Bidlync makes this data searchable, filterable, and actionable — so you can find relevant opportunities in seconds instead of hours.

What is Grants.gov?

Grants.gov is the central hub for finding and applying to federal grant opportunities. It aggregates grants from all federal agencies. Bidlync brings this data into a modern, filterable interface with AI-powered tools to help you find grants that match your business and mission.
